The stance on cryptocurrency policies stands to significantly influence the outcome of the upcoming 2025 New Jersey governor election. The organization known as 'Stand With Crypto' boasts about 62,000 dedicated members in New Jersey, emphasizing the potential impact that these voters could have on the electoral process, particularly considering that the margin of victory in the 2021 governor election was a mere 84,000 votes. Emerging data from recent surveys reveals that an impressive 63% of the organization's members are inclined to rally behind candidates who advocate for cryptocurrency.
In stark contrast, only 17% of these voters have expressed a willingness to support candidates opposing favorable crypto policies. This insight highlights a significant voting bloc that could sway the results of the election. As the political landscape evolves, it's worth noting that the sitting governor, Phil Murphy, is ineligible to run again due to term limits.
With this development, the final candidates for the election will be determined in the upcoming June primary, leaving the path open for new leadership. Interestingly, while the members of 'Stand With Crypto' generally show a leaning towards the Republican Party, recent feedback indicates that 45% of them are open to changing their voting preferences.
This suggests a dynamic voter base that could be influenced by which candidates align most closely with their views on cryptocurrency regulation.
